The Scout Fellowship

       Provides a first class opportunity to make friends and support Scouting in your Local community.

What does it do?

       The Scout Movement depends on its leaders to run Beavers, Cubs, Scouts and Venture Scouts. These Leaders need and deserve support. Everybody has some skill or experience that they can offer, what their age or ability. These talents are organized and made available to Leaders via the Scout Fellowship

So who belongs?

    In fact, just about anyone.

     Members of the Fellowship are Associate Members of the Scout Movement and may become Full Members if they wish by making the Scout Promise.

What will you have to do?

    No one should worry that Membership may make unreasonable demands on time and energy. The Fellowship exist to provide support effectively, whether members can manage many an evening or week-end or only the occasional day in the year. Support is required from everyone be little or a great deal.
